Equipment Details
MECHANICAL
- 3.5L DOHC EFI 24-valve V6 engine
- 6-speed automatic ECT-i transmission w/OD & sequential shift
- Battery saver
- Dual rear exhaust
- Dual variable valve timing w/intelligence
- Dual-link MacPherson strut rear suspension w/stabilizer bar
- Engine speed-sensing variable-assist pwr rack & pinion steering
- Front wheel drive
- Full size spare tire w/alloy wheel
- MacPherson strut front suspension w/stabilizer bar
- Pwr ventilated front/solid rear disc brakes
EXTERIOR
- Color-keyed bumpers
- High solar energy-absorbing (HSEA) glass
INTERIOR
- (2) 12-volt aux pwr outlets
- Adjustable headrests for all seating positions
- Digital clock
- Direct tire pressure monitor system
- Dual illuminated visor vanity mirrors
- Dual-zone automatic climate control w/air filtration, rear seat vents
- Front center console storage area-inc: sliding armrest, dual cup holders, coin holder
- Front/rear reading lamps
- HD rear defogger w/timer
- Illuminated entry w/fade-out exit system
- In-glass diversity antenna
- Multi-function information display-inc: message, audio, climate control, outside temp, trip computer
- Optitron instrumentation-inc: tachometer, coolant temp
- Pwr door locks w/anti-lockout feature
- Pwr trunk & fuel-filler door releases
- Pwr windows-inc: front auto-touch control, jam protection, retained pwr
- Rear center armrest w/cup holders
SAFETY
- 3-point seatbelts for all passenger seating positions w/front adjustable shoulder belt anchors
- Child protector rear door locks
- Child restraint system w/rear seat lower anchors, tether anchor brackets
- Driver & front passenger advanced airbags w/occupant sensor
- Driver & front passenger seat-mounted side-impact airbags
- Driver knee airbag
- Energy-absorbing collapsible steering column
- Front & rear side curtain airbags
- Front/rear crumple zones
- Internal trunk-release handle
- Outboard front seatbelt pretensioners w/force limiters
- Side-impact door beams

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 7,600 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2008 TOYOTA AVALON in 2008 was $37,825.
The average price for used 2008 TOYOTA AVALON nowadays in 2024 is $9,000 which is 24%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 10,154 miles.
